Full name: Joseph Steve Sakic
Eyes: green
Hair: dark brown
Height: 180 cm (5' 11)
Weight: 84 kg (185 lbs.)
Born: 7/7/69 in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ada
Parents: Marijan (carpenter) and Slavica (ensembeled electronic parts), both
emigrated from Croatia in the age of 17
Siblings: Brian (hockey player, born 4/9/71) and Rosemarie (ex- figure skater coach
nowadays, current last name Sakic- Friel)
Other family: Joe met his wife Debbie when Joe was 17 and Debbie 16 they went to
high school together, they have 3 kids Mitchell (born 4/10/96) and mixed twins Kamryn and Chase (born 14/10/00)
Current residence: Littleton, a town outside Denver
1st car: White Pontiac Firebird '81

Nicknames: Super Joe, Burnaby Joe, Quoteless Joe
Other stuff:
- Joe's a partial owner of italian restaurant Santino's
- He used to own a little part of a hockey team called Calgary Hitmen, other co-ownes
included wrestler Brett "The Hitman" Hart and NHL:ler Theo Fleury
- Hates the bobblehead made of him, says it doesn't look like him (I agree)
- Likes baseball, favorite team is Seattle Mariners and favorite player is Ichiro
- Also likes european football, favorite player Davor Suker of Croatia and Joe
owns his jersey too
- Was in a bus crash 30/12/87, Joe survived, but some of his team mates didn't.
He says that after that accident he started to drive more carefully
- Joe likes to watch women's tennis "The action and the volleys"
- Players he likes to watch: Mario Lemieux, Sergei Fedorov, Wayne Gretzky, Michael
Jordan, Monica Seles
- Joe and his wife do charity with Food Bank Of The Rockies. Joe hosts Joe Sakic
Celebrity Classic annually
- Joe's boyhood idol was Wayne Gretzky
- On road Joe's roommate is Alex Tanguay whose boyhood idol was, who else, Joe
Sakic
